Premade essays defined

Before we start pondering on premade essays, let us define them. Thus, premade essays are academic papers written in advance by professional writers and specialists for online service providers. Topics for premade essays are also determined in advance.

These essays are stored in online databases waiting for customers to access them either for educational purposes or for using them as ready papers for submission as term papers. The main difference between premade essays and custom essays is the fact that the former are written according to a topic, while the latter try to follow every customer’s instructions to the letter thus creating a unique paper.
